The Importance of Employee Experience

The term employee experience encompasses every aspect of the employee’s journey within an organization—from recruitment and onboarding to career development and beyond. A positive employee experience contributes to greater job satisfaction, higher retention rates, and improved productivity. According to recent studies, companies that prioritize employee experience see up to a 20% increase in revenue and a notable decrease in turnover costs.

Key Components of Employee Experience

Understanding the key components of employee experience is crucial for organizations seeking effective solutions. Some of the vital elements include:

  • Culture and Values: A strong organizational culture that resonates with employees can significantly enhance their commitment and loyalty.
  • Work Environment: A safe, inclusive, and engaging workspace boosts morale and enhances productivity.
  • Technology and Tools: Providing access to the right tools and technology enhances employee efficiency and satisfaction.
  • Career Development: Offering learning and growth opportunities keeps employees motivated and engaged.
  • Feedback Mechanisms: Regular feedback contributes to a culture of openness and continuous improvement.

Implementing Employee Experience Solutions

Implementing employee experience solutions requires a strategic approach. Here are some effective strategies for successful implementation:

Step 1: Assess Current Employee Experience

Conduct surveys and focus groups to gather feedback on the current employee experience. Understanding the strengths and weaknesses of your current policies is essential for improvement.

Step 2: Define Your Goals and Objectives

Establish clear objectives for what you want to achieve with your employee experience solutions. This could range from increasing engagement scores to enhancing career development opportunities.

Step 3: Involve Employees in the Process

Involve employees in the design and implementation of new solutions. Their insights can provide valuable input and foster a sense of ownership and buy-in.

Step 4: Choose the Right Tools and Technologies

Select tools and technologies that align with your goals and enhance the employee experience. This could involve collaboration tools, feedback platforms, and learning management systems.

Step 5: Monitor and Adjust

Continuously assess the impact of your employee experience solutions. Use key performance indicators to measure success and make adjustments as necessary.

Innovative Employee Experience Solutions

With the advancement of technology, companies have access to various innovative employee experience solutions. Let’s explore some of these cutting-edge strategies:

1. Personalized Employee Journeys

Utilize data analytics to create personalized employee journeys. By understanding individual preferences and career goals, organizations can tailor experiences, improving overall satisfaction and performance.

2. Integration of AI and Automation

Incorporating artificial intelligence (AI) can streamline HR processes, offer personalized support, and enhance decision-making processes. Automated surveys and feedback loops can help gather real-time insights into employee sentiment.

3. Employee Well-being Programs

Launch well-being initiatives that address mental, physical, and emotional health. Programs that encourage work-life balance, stress management, and fitness can significantly improve the overall employee experience.

4. Flexible Work Arrangements

Incorporate options for flexible work hours and remote work. Allowing employees to choose how and when they work can lead to improved morale and productivity.

5. Continuous Learning and Development

Invest in continuous learning opportunities to keep employees engaged and equipped with the latest skills. E-learning platforms, workshops, and mentoring programs can significantly enhance employee experience.
